Hey plugin authors — we've spotted drift between what the docs say and what the Wirepost gateway actually runs. Compression (permessage-deflate) got tuned down on two production nodes after a memory scare, so some of your plugins are seeing bigger frames than expected. The tradeoff: higher compression saves bandwidth but eats gateway RAM per connection, and we have a lot of idle connections. We're standardizing everything this week so behavior is consistent. The settings we're converging on are below.

deployment values, yafop-tahof:
HOLIX_HOST=holix.zemvarsys.internal
HOLIX_PORT=3306

# Break-Glass: Catalog Cache Invalidation

Scope: the Pinrow product catalog at Veldstone Retail. If stale prices persist after a purge and the Hollowmere invalidation queue is wedged, use break-glass to flush the edge tier directly. Contractors: get verbal sign-off from the catalog lead first. Steps: open the Hollowmere admin shell, select emergency-flush, confirm the tenant, and run it once — repeated flushes thrash the origin. Access is logged and expires after 20 minutes. Unseal the admin shell with the passphrase below.

recovery phrase for kahop-tajog: istix-casvan

Subject: Pipewren cut-over complete

All,

Compaction cut-over on Pipewren finished last night. Old segments are retired; compacted topics are live. Plugin authors: consumers must tolerate tombstones and key-based retention from today. No replays planned. Report anomalies by Friday. Current broker compaction settings follow below.

service settings:
[silwyn]
host = silwyn.crelvogrid.internal
user = silwyn_svc
database = silwyn_prod